近年来,全球人工智能行业逐渐形成以算法框架为核心,以Google、Facebook、微软、亚马逊等IT巨头为主导的竞争格局。然而,2017年12月,美国一家致力于创建高级加速标准的开源组织Khronos Group,发布了神经网络交换格式NNEF,并作为多种主流算法框架的通用格式,使得原有的竞争格局发生重大变化。NNEF的使用能够降低算法框架的碎片问题,实现不同公司部门训练的算法模型能够在各种设备和平台上便捷高效利用,有利于推进人工智能开放生态的建设。
算法框架开放生态的建设对推动人工智能发展意义重大。一是加速前沿性研究向应用转化。在基于NNEF的开放生态下,在任意研究型框架上训练的神经网络模型,可以经过格式转换在另一个应用型框架上直接使用。这种转换将人工智能的前沿研究和产品更紧密地结合在一起,简化了由研究到生产的具体流程,极大地提升了人工智能前沿研究的产品化和应用开发速度。二是提高人工智能创新速度。开放生态简化了硬件供应商针对每一套框架的优化流程,提高了软硬件的适配度,在此基础上,算法框架开发商专注于创新增强,人工智能项目开发商只需进行最优框架的选择,硬件开发商可以精简优化流程,这将极大提升人工智能社区的协作创新速度。更重要的是,由于Google和苹果等厂商在定制硬件之上掌握着更多人工智能框架优化控制权,因此保障框架间的互操作性变得尤为重要,能够帮助其他厂商打破龙头企业的技术垄断权,谋求发展机会。三是形成国际技术标准。NNEF表达格式提供了一个用于表示神经网络学习模型的标准,解决了当下主流开发框架碎片化的问题,实现模型在不同框架间的转移,形成通用的国际标准。这种算法框架的技术标准是实现新型开放生态系统的基础,将使得AI真正拥有可访问性与价值实现能力。基于此,我国也应加紧人工智能开放生态的布局。
推动算法框架相关软硬件协同发展。牢牢把握算法框架创新源头和方向,实施重大科技项目,支持算法框架和与其适配的人工智能芯片、处理器的研发生产。密切关注神经网络交换格式等开放技术标准、面向算法框架的优化等技术的最新进展,鼓励企业和科研院所尽快展开相关课题研究,掌握核心技术,就通用格式和转換格式进行前瞻性研究布局。
(赛迪智库)endprint